## **Risk management & AML regulations.** 

The Trustees are responsible for the management of risks faced by the charity. The Trustees have undertaken a full 

This is very small organisation with only 3 staff members and 8 Trustees. The staff members are not any way connected with the finance and management. They are directly supervised by the Chairman, the Trustee 

on daily basis and other Trustees bi monthly basis. No payments are made without the knowledge of the Chair who is in constant touch with the Trustee. The Chair, the Vice Chair and the Trustees are only the cheque signatories. Only the Chair and the Treasurer operate the Bank jointly. 

The Trustees are satisfied that the major risks identified have been adequately mitigated where necessary. It is recognised that systems can only provide reasonable but not absolute assurance that major risks have been adequately managed. 

We do not accept foreign donations or make payments other than the printing cost. Due diligence is observed for all payments and on receipt of invoices. Payments are made only after authorised by the Chair.

## **Going Concern** 

The Trust does not have any loans, debentures or future legal commitment. The 2025 account deficit is not usual and most unlikely to recur. There are no 'gearing' issue in the Balance Sheet and has a very good cash reserve. The Trustees are fully and completely believe the Trust will continue to operate in the foreseeable future without any problem.
